The School of Medicine of the University of Navarra has been teaching the degree scroll Expert in Immuno-Oncology since academic year 2014/2015. The programme has the partnership of Bristol-Myers Squibb, a world leader in drugs for the treatment of cardiovascular and oncological diseases, and is taught mainly at the Campus of the University of Navarra in Madrid.
goal More than 350 alumni have completed a programme whose main aim is to provide the specialist in Medical Oncology and Haematology with an additional specific training in cancer immunotherapy from a theoretical approach and internship.
Thus, at the end of the programme, student will have an updated view of the immune response against cancer, will know the mechanisms involved in the evasion of the immune response and will have an overview of pre-clinical and clinical protocols and marketed products that can be offered as prophylaxis or immunological treatment to fight cancer.
